Having a jolly old time watching the "Concert for George".

If you have never seen it, it is an astonishing tribute to George Harrison. Comes in three parts....

The first is an Indian music tribute based on his love of the subcontinent.

Then Monty python are on!!! (I kid you not...they do a rousing rendition of sit on my face, lumberjack etc etc)

Then the concert proper.

Where else do you get Jeff Lynn, Joe Brown, Paul McCartney, Tom Petty, Eric Clapton, Billy Preston (plus loads more), an orchestra, three drum kits all going together and more guitars than you can poke a stick at!!!!

Pops up on sky arts now and then, and is currently on Now TV if you have it.

Well worth a watch!!
